Door Closer Installation in Conroe, TX
Door closer installation services involve adding or replacing devices that control the closing of interior or exterior doors, ensuring they close smoothly and securely.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ading existing door closers, installing new units on entry doors, or replacing damaged or malfunctioning closers to maintain safety, security, and convenience for residential properties. Homeowners typically seek this service when doors no longer close properly, if they want to improve energy efficiency, or if they are upgrading their property’s security features.
Before requesting door closer installation, property owners often want to understand the different types of door closers available, such as hydraulic or pneumatic models, and which is best suited for their specific door and usage needs. They may also inquire about compatibility with existing door hardware, the importance of proper mounting height, and how the new closer will affect the door’s operation. Clarifying these details helps ensure the selected door closer functions effectively and meets the property’s safety and security requirements.

Door Closer Installation Questions
What is a door closer? A door closer is a device installed at the top of a door that controls its closing speed and ensures it closes securely after use.
When should a door closer be installed? Installation is recommended when a door needs to close automatically for security, fire safety, or convenience.
Are there different types of door closers? Yes, options include surface-mounted, concealed, and hydraulic door closers, suitable for various door types and settings.
What are common reasons to replace a door closer? Replacement is often needed if the door no longer closes properly, makes noise, or the closer shows signs of wear or damage.
